Abstract
A plurality of radio pagers which can perform apparatus related tasks and which include the same unique pager address ID code, emulate to an available commercial paging service a single pager having the unique pager address ID code, in responding with an acknowledgement transmission to receipt by the plurality of radio pagers to a location request transmission from the available commercial paging service of the unique pager address ID code.

1. A system for remote performance of apparatus related tasks through an available commercial paging service that is configured to transmit a pager address code by radio to a plurality of pagers wherein each pager of said plurality of pagers has a unique pager address code that is different from the pager address codes of the other pagers of the plurality of pagers, and in which the commercial paging service transmits a first pager address code belonging to one of said plurality of pagers, whereby a pager which receives the transmission of its own unique pager address code transmits an acknowledgment signal to the paging service, the system comprising:
a plurality of task pagers at least one of the plurality of task pagers comprising means for interfacing with an apparatus, each of the plurality of task pagers having control means programmed for controlling its functions, and having the same pager address code as the other ones of the plurality of task pagers and being configured to receive a transmission of the same pager address code from the available commercial paging service, only one task pager of said plurality of task pagers being a master pager programmed to transmit an acknowledgment signal to the paging service in response to said same pager address code, the remaining ones of said plurality of task pagers receiving the same transmission of said same pager address code being programmed to not transmit the acknowledgment signal to the paging service. - View Dependent Claims (2, 3, 4)

5. A method for remote performance of apparatus related tasks by radio communication between a radio pager and an available commercial paging service which broadcasts a signal, the radio pager having means for interfacing with apparatus and for processing a radio signal received by the pager and controlling functions of the pager, the method comprising the pager performing the steps of:
-
(a) receiving the broadcast signal, (b) determining whether the signal includes the pager'"'"'s address ID code, (c) if in step (b) the pager determines that the signal does not include the pager'"'"'s address ID code, the pager going into standby, (d) if in step (b) the pager determines that the signal does include the pager'"'"'s address ID code, and the pager is a master pager, transmitting an acknowledgment signal to the available commercial paging service and performing step (f), (e) if in step (b) the pager determines that the signal does include the pager'"'"'s address ID code, and the pager is not a master pager, performing step (f), (f) determining whether the signal includes an individual pager ID code that matches the pager'"'"'s own individual ID code, wherein an individual pager ID code is different from the pager'"'"'s pager address ID code, and performing the apparatus related task addressed by the signal for performance by a pager with the pager'"'"'s own individual ID code. - View Dependent Claims (6)

7. A method for remote performance of apparatus related tasks by radio communication between a plurality of radio pagers each comprising the same pager address ID code, and an available commercial paging service which broadcasts a signal, the radio pagers comprising means for interfacing with apparatus and each pager comprising means for processing a radio signal received by the pager and controlling functions of the pager, the method comprising each of the plurality of pagers performing the steps of:
-
(a) receiving the broadcast signal, (b) determining whether the signal includes the pager'"'"'s address ID code, (c) if in step (b) the pager determines that the signal does not include the pager'"'"'s address ID code, the pager going into standby, (d) if in step (b) the pager determines that the signal does include the pager'"'"'s address ID code, and the pager is a master pager, transmitting an acknowledgment signal to the available commercial paging service and performing step (f), (e) if in step (b) the pager determines that the signal does include the pager'"'"'s address ID code, and the pager is not a master pager, not transmitting an acknowledgment signal to the available commercial paging service and performing step (f), (f) performing the apparatus related task specific for the pager according to instruction from the available commercial paging service.

8. A pager for performance of an apparatus related task in response to instruction by radio communication between an available commercial paging service which communicates with pagers by radio, the pager comprising means for interfacing with apparatus and for processing a radio signal received by the pager and for programmed control of functions of the pager, the pager being programmed to:
-
(a) receive a pager address ID code inquiry broadcast signal on the frequency broadcast by the available commercial paging service, (b) determine whether the signal includes the pager'"'"'s address ID code, (c) if the pager determines that the signal does not include the pager'"'"'s address ID code, go into standby, (d) if the pager determines that the signal does include the pager'"'"'s address ID code, and the pager is a master pager, transmit an acknowledgment signal to the available commercial paging service and perform (f), (e) if the pager determines that the signal does include the pager'"'"'s address ID code, and the pager is not a master pager, do not transmit an acknowledgment signal to the available commercial paging service and perform (f), (f) perform the apparatus related task specific for the pager according to instruction from the available commercial paging service.
